Product description

tesa® 60388 is a double sided electrically conductive self-adhesive tape. It consists of electrically conductive non-woven backing and specially modified conductive adhesive coating layers for high bonding properties on both sides. Designed for grounding and shielding which needs higher bonding performance such as FPC, PCB, antenna and other components applications.

Application Fields

  • EMC applications
  • FPC, PCB for grounding
  • Antenna and other components in electronics device
Backing material conductive non-woven
Colour grey
Colour of liner transparent
Thickness of liner 50 µm
Total thickness 100
Type of adhesive conductive acrylic
Type of liner PET film
Contact resistance z-direction (initial) 0.06 Ohm / square inch
Surface resistance x-y-direction 0.3 Ohm / square
Adhesion to Steel (initial) 8 N/cm
Adhesion to Steel (after 14 days) 10 N/cm
